Hello to all, but in particular anyone in the North West! The Western Washington Firebird Club was started by a couple of local F-Body enthusiasts about 15 years ago, and to date we have over 200 members! While many are not very active in all the clubs events, we do have a Monthly Newsletter, and Monthly events raging from Tech Sessions to general Cruises to Drive-In Nights to gatherings to show enthusiasts from out of town (often other countries) a good time and a large gathering of Firebirds! We also do events with other local car clubs, such as the NW Legends GTO Club ( GTO Club ) , local POCI chapter and the NW Camaro club etc...

We have an annual Pic-Nic, and an annual All Pontiac Car Show! Our first show alone, we had over 23 First Gen Convertibles participate and almost 200 cars in all!
